ZigBee2007协议规范概述:低成本、低功耗无线通信标准

需积分: 9 1 下载量 99 浏览量 更新于2024-07-27 收藏 677KB PDF 举报
"《ZigBee2007协议规范》是ZigBee联盟制定的一份技术文档,旨在定义一种低成本、低功耗的双向无线通信标准,广泛应用于消费电子、家居与楼宇自动化、工业控制等领域。该规范详细阐述了ZigBee协议的各个层次和组件,包括应用支持子层(APS)、ZigBee设备对象(ZDO)、ZigBee设备配置(ZDP)、应用程序构架层、网络层(NWK)以及安全服务。文件053474r1为ZigBee标准组织的版权内容,旨在为ZigBee协议的实施提供清晰指导,促进兼容且经济的产品开发。" ZigBee协议栈基于IEEE 802.15.4-2003标准,该标准定义了物理层(PHY)和媒体访问控制子层(MAC)。ZigBee联盟在这些基础上构建了网络层和应用层架构。应用层架构包含了APS、ZDO,而制造商定义的应用对象则利用这些架构层和共享的服务。PHY层分为两个频段,868/915MHz用于欧洲和部分国家,2.4GHz在全球范围内通用。MAC子层采用载波监听多路访问/冲突避免(CSMA-CA)机制来管理无线信道的访问,确保有效且可靠的通信。 ZigBee协议栈的结构层次分明,每层都提供特定的服务。数据实体负责数据传输,管理实体则提供其他服务。服务实体通过服务接入点(SAP)向上层提供接口,SAP支持多种服务原语以完成各自的功能。ZDO负责设备管理和网络配置,而APS则处理应用层的数据传输和安全服务。 ZigBee2007规范中的ZDO包含设备发现、网络管理和设备配置等功能,使得ZigBee网络能够自动形成、维护和管理。APS则提供数据封装、路由选择和服务质量保证,确保数据在复杂网络环境中的正确传递。 1.1.1范围部分强调了ZigBee协议规范涵盖了从底层通信到高层应用的全面描述,包括接口、对象和算法的细节。1.1.2目的部分明确了规范的意图,即为开发者提供清晰的指南,以创建与ZigBee标准兼容的低成本产品。1.1.3协议栈结构部分详细解释了ZigBee协议栈的分层设计,以及各层之间的交互方式。 《ZigBee2007协议规范》是理解和实施ZigBee技术的关键文档,它定义了从物理层到应用层的完整通信流程,为各种应用场景提供了坚实的技术基础。